* [PATCH 1/4] ref-manual: remove checkpkg task
@ 2021-09-15 10:12 Michael Opdenacker
  2021-09-15 10:12 ` [PATCH 2/4] ref-manual: improve "devtool check-upgrade-status" details Michael Opdenacker
                   ` (3 more replies)
  0 siblings, 4 replies; 9+ messages in thread
From: Michael Opdenacker @ 2021-09-15 10:12 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: docs; +Cc: Michael Opdenacker

It doesn't exist any more and its functionality is now taken care
of by "devtool check-upgrade-status"

* [PATCH 2/4] ref-manual: improve "devtool check-upgrade-status" details
  2021-09-15 10:12 [PATCH 1/4] ref-manual: remove checkpkg task Michael Opdenacker
@ 2021-09-15 10:12 ` Michael Opdenacker
  2021-09-15 11:44   ` [docs] " Quentin Schulz
  2021-09-15 10:12 ` [PATCH 3/4] ref-manual: improve documentation for RECIPE_NO_UPDATE_REASON Michael Opdenacker
                   ` (2 subsequent siblings)
  3 siblings, 1 reply; 9+ messages in thread
From: Michael Opdenacker @ 2021-09-15 10:12 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: docs; +Cc: Michael Opdenacker

- Mention "devtool latest-version recipe" to process a single version
- Explain that the mechanism is controlled by the UPSTREAM_CHECK*
  variables, which are not referred to anywhere else in the manuals,
  except in the variable index.

Signed-off-by: Michael Opdenacker <michael.opdenacker@bootlin.com>
---
 documentation/ref-manual/devtool-reference.rst | 18 ++++++++++++------
 1 file changed, 12 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-)

diff --git a/documentation/ref-manual/devtool-reference.rst b/documentation/ref-manual/devtool-reference.rst
index 5fd51569a3..5a0d6c25ae 100644
--- a/documentation/ref-manual/devtool-reference.rst
+++ b/documentation/ref-manual/devtool-reference.rst
@@ -328,12 +328,18 @@ Checking on the Upgrade Status of a Recipe
 Upstream recipes change over time. Consequently, you might find that you
 need to determine if you can upgrade a recipe to a newer version.
 
-To check on the upgrade status of a recipe, use the
-``devtool check-upgrade-status`` command. The command displays a table
-of your current recipe versions, the latest upstream versions, the email
-address of the recipe's maintainer, and any additional information such
-as commit hash strings and reasons you might not be able to upgrade a
-particular recipe.
+To check on the upgrade status of a recipe, you can use the
+``devtool latest-version recipe`` command, which quickly shows the current
+version and the latest version available upstream. To get such information
+for all available recipes,  use the ``devtool check-upgrade-status`` command.
+The command displays a table of your current recipe versions, the latest
+upstream versions, the email address of the recipe's maintainer, and any
+additional information such as commit hash strings and reasons you might
+not be able to upgrade a particular recipe.
+
+This upgrade checking mechanism relies on the :term:`UPSTREAM_CHECK_URI`,
+:term:`UPSTREAM_CHECK_REGEX` and :term:`UPSTREAM_CHECK_GITTAGREGEX` variables
+which can be defined in each recipe.

* [PATCH 3/4] ref-manual: improve documentation for RECIPE_NO_UPDATE_REASON
  2021-09-15 10:12 [PATCH 1/4] ref-manual: remove checkpkg task Michael Opdenacker
  2021-09-15 10:12 ` [PATCH 2/4] ref-manual: improve "devtool check-upgrade-status" details Michael Opdenacker
@ 2021-09-15 10:12 ` Michael Opdenacker
  2021-09-15 11:54   ` [docs] " Quentin Schulz
  2021-09-15 10:12 ` [PATCH 4/4] ref-manual: update "devtool check-upgrade-status" output Michael Opdenacker
  2021-09-15 11:40 ` [docs] [PATCH 1/4] ref-manual: remove checkpkg task Quentin Schulz
  3 siblings, 1 reply; 9+ messages in thread
From: Michael Opdenacker @ 2021-09-15 10:12 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: docs; +Cc: Michael Opdenacker

This add a description of this variable to the variable index,
and clarifies the explanations given in the devtool reference
section.

Signed-off-by: Michael Opdenacker <michael.opdenacker@bootlin.com>
---
 documentation/ref-manual/devtool-reference.rst | 13 ++++---------
 documentation/ref-manual/variables.rst         |  7 +++++++
 2 files changed, 11 insertions(+), 9 deletions(-)

diff --git a/documentation/ref-manual/devtool-reference.rst b/documentation/ref-manual/devtool-reference.rst
index 5a0d6c25ae..761c7cb738 100644
--- a/documentation/ref-manual/devtool-reference.rst
+++ b/documentation/ref-manual/devtool-reference.rst
@@ -375,15 +375,10 @@ Following is a partial example table that reports on all the recipes.
 Notice the reported reason for not upgrading the ``base-passwd`` recipe.
 In this example, while a new version is available upstream, you do not
 want to use it because the dependency on ``cdebconf`` is not easily
-satisfied.
-
-.. note::
-
-   When a reason for not upgrading displays, the reason is usually
-   written into the recipe using the ``RECIPE_NO_UPDATE_REASON``
-   variable. See the
-   :yocto_git:`base-passwd.bb </poky/tree/meta/recipes-core/base-passwd/base-passwd_3.5.29.bb>`
-   recipe for an example.
+satisfied. Maintainers can explicit the reason that is shown by adding
+the :term:`RECIPE_NO_UPDATE_REASON` variable to the corresponding recipe.
+See :yocto_git:`base-passwd.bb </poky/tree/meta/recipes-core/base-passwd/base-passwd_3.5.29.bb>`
+for an example.
 
 ::
 
diff --git a/documentation/ref-manual/variables.rst b/documentation/ref-manual/variables.rst
index 74d04dfd49..ecad6acfff 100644
--- a/documentation/ref-manual/variables.rst
+++ b/documentation/ref-manual/variables.rst
@@ -6132,6 +6132,13 @@ system and gives an overview of their function and contents.
       BitBake User Manual for additional information on tasks and
       dependencies.
 
+   :term:`RECIPE_NO_UPDATE_REASON`
+      If a recipe should not be replaced by a more recent upstream version,
+      setting this variable in a recipe allows to explain the reason why in
+      the output of the ``devtool check-upgrade-status`` command, as explained
+      in the ":ref:`ref-manual/devtool-reference:checking on the upgrade Status of a recipe`"
+      section.

* Re: [docs] [PATCH 2/4] ref-manual: improve "devtool check-upgrade-status" details
  2021-09-15 10:12 ` [PATCH 2/4] ref-manual: improve "devtool check-upgrade-status" details Michael Opdenacker
@ 2021-09-15 11:44   ` Quentin Schulz
  2021-09-15 12:42     ` Michael Opdenacker
  0 siblings, 1 reply; 9+ messages in thread
From: Quentin Schulz @ 2021-09-15 11:44 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: Michael Opdenacker; +Cc: docs

Hi Michael,

On Wed, Sep 15, 2021 at 12:12:17PM +0200, Michael Opdenacker wrote:
> - Mention "devtool latest-version recipe" to process a single version
> - Explain that the mechanism is controlled by the UPSTREAM_CHECK*
>   variables, which are not referred to anywhere else in the manuals,
>   except in the variable index.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Michael Opdenacker <michael.opdenacker@bootlin.com>
> ---
>  documentation/ref-manual/devtool-reference.rst | 18 ++++++++++++------
>  1 file changed, 12 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-)
> 
> diff --git a/documentation/ref-manual/devtool-reference.rst b/documentation/ref-manual/devtool-reference.rst
> index 5fd51569a3..5a0d6c25ae 100644
> --- a/documentation/ref-manual/devtool-reference.rst
> +++ b/documentation/ref-manual/devtool-reference.rst
> @@ -328,12 +328,18 @@ Checking on the Upgrade Status of a Recipe
>  Upstream recipes change over time. Consequently, you might find that you
>  need to determine if you can upgrade a recipe to a newer version.
>  
> -To check on the upgrade status of a recipe, use the
> -``devtool check-upgrade-status`` command. The command displays a table
> -of your current recipe versions, the latest upstream versions, the email
> -address of the recipe's maintainer, and any additional information such
> -as commit hash strings and reasons you might not be able to upgrade a
> -particular recipe.
> +To check on the upgrade status of a recipe, you can use the
> +``devtool latest-version recipe`` command, which quickly shows the current
> +version and the latest version available upstream. To get such information
> +for all available recipes,  use the ``devtool check-upgrade-status`` command.

Spurious space before `use` here.

> +The command displays a table of your current recipe versions, the latest
> +upstream versions, the email address of the recipe's maintainer, and any
> +additional information such as commit hash strings and reasons you might
> +not be able to upgrade a particular recipe.
> +
> +This upgrade checking mechanism relies on the :term:`UPSTREAM_CHECK_URI`,
> +:term:`UPSTREAM_CHECK_REGEX` and :term:`UPSTREAM_CHECK_GITTAGREGEX` variables
> +which can be defined in each recipe.
>  

I think the "can be defined in each recipe" might generate confusion and
tell people it can be defined elsewhere.

What about:

"""
This upgrade checking mechanism relies on the optional[...] variables
which are defined in package recipes.
"""

What do you think?
